Two officers martyred, several injured in blast near police station in Bara Bazar

Khyber: An explosion occurred near police station in Khyber's Bara Bazar in which two officers were martyred while several people have sustained the injuries on Thursday.
According to the police, blast occurred near the main gate of police station after which heavy firing also took place in the area.
It has been reported that police surrounded the area and rescue personnel have reached the scene.
They shifted the eight injured to a nearby hospital for immediate medical assistance.
According to police, the nature of the explosion is not immediately known, but Bomb Disposal Squad (BDS) has been called in the area.
They also told that preliminary investigation shows that explosion in Bara Bazar seems to be suicide.
